Sending Happy Mail

Here's my card for this week's sketch at Freshly Made Sketches.  I replaced the layout's round panel with a fun envelope die cut to make a perfect card to let someone know you're thinking about them.

Sending Happy Mail card-designed by Lori Tecler/Inking Aloud-stamps and dies from Lil' Inker Designs
I used the large envelope die from the Mini Envelopes and Accessories set from Lil' Inker Designs to cut the envelope from white cardstock.  For contrast, I added a die cut red heart "seal" to the envelope.  It was adhered to a gray polka dotted panel.  I topped the envelope with a sentiment made with a combination of a die cut and stamped text.  The "sending" was cut from gray cardstock.  For dimension, but easy mailing, I cut the word again several more times from a lightweight cardstock, then stacked and adhered the die cut pieces.  The "happy mail" sentiment from the Sending You set was stamped on a small red cardstock strip and adhered just beneath the die cut word.  The finished panel was adhered to a pale gray card base.

Materials Used: 
Sending You stamp set, Mini Envelopes and Accessories and Of the Heart dies (Lil' Inker Designs); Memento Tuxedo Black ink (Tsukineko/IMAGINE Crafts); Steel Grey and Grout Gray cardstock (My Favorite Things); Real Red cardstock (Stampin' Up!); Grey Mini Dot designer paper (Michaels); foam tape
